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Damage Repair in Green Haven, MD

Catching the signs of subfloor water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ent musty odors can show moisture buildup in your subfloor, leading to mold growth and health problems.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age to your subfloor, which can lead to structural issues and costly repairs.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your walls, ceiling, or floors can show water damage to your subfloor.

Peeling Paint or Drywall

Peeling paint or drywall can be a sign of water damage to your subfloor, which can lead to structural issues and costly repairs.

Unusual Noises or Creaks

Unusual noises or creaks coming from your floors or walls can show water damage to your subfloor, which can lead to structural issues and costly repairs.

Visible Water Leaks

Visible water leaks from pipes, appliances, or fixtures can show water damage to your subfloor.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water has flooded your entire subfloor. No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ment to dry and repair the area quickly and effectively.
Your subfloor has been damaged by a small leak. Yes No You can likely repair the damage yourself with some basic tools and materials.
Your subfloor has been damaged by a large-scale flood. No Yes You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to dry and repair the area quickly and effectively.
You’re not sure where the water damage is coming from. No Yes A professional will be able to identify the source of the damage and develop a plan to repair it.
You have a large area of damaged flooring. No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to dry and repair the area quickly and effectively.
You’re on a tight budget and want to save money. Yes No While DIY repairs may seem like a cost-effective option, they can often end up costing more in the long run if not done properly.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ost in Green Haven, MD

The cost of subfloor water damage repair services can vary widely depending on the extent of the damage, the materials required for repairs, and the location of the property. Here are some estimated price ranges for common subfloor water damage repair services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Drying and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the amount of water damage, and the complexity of the repair.
Demolition and Removal $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of damaged material, the complexity of the repair, and the location of the property.
Repairs and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area, the materials required for repairs, and the complexity of the repair.
Final Inspection and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age, the complexity of the repair, and the location of the property.
